First Monday has just published the April 2015 (volume 20, number 4) issue at http://firstmonday.org/issue/current.

The following papers are included in this month's issue:

First Monday
Volume 20, Number 4 - 6 April 2015

Special issue: Digital gender: Toward a new generation of insights

Digital gender: Perspective, phenomena, practice
by Viktor Arvidsson and Anna Foka 

Sluts ‘r’ us: Intersections of gender, protocol and agency in the digital age
by Nishant Shah

On trans-, glitch, and gender as machinery of failure
by Jenny Sundén

Toxic femininity 4.0
by Roopika Risam

Embodying culture: Interactive installation on women’s rights
by Patrizia Marti, Jeroen Peeters, Ambra Trotto, Michele Tittarelli, Nicholas True, Nigel Papworth, and Caroline Hummels

Shame transfigured: Slut-shaming from Rome to cyberspace
by Lewis Webb

Seeing through the fog: Digital problems and solutions for studying ancient women
by Alex McAuley

With the contents of the April 2015 issue, First Monday has published, since May 1996, 1,453 papers in 227 issues, written by 2,009 different authors.
